Giotto Italian Restaurant


Home » Giotto Italian Restaurant

Giotto Italian Restaurant

Share this profile
About

Get delicious, authentic Pizza in Tottenham Court Road at Giotto Italian Restaurant. Nestled on New Oxford Street, just moments away from Tottenham Court Road station and within close proximity to Shaftesbury and Dominion Theatres as well as the British Museum, we have been a cherished family-run Italian restaurant since 1996. Our culinary offerings represent a harmonious blend of authentic Italian flavours, ranging from delectable antipasti to mouth-watering stone-baked pizzas and freshly prepared pasta dishes. Our dedicated kitchen team, boasting over 15 years of experience, pours their passion into every dish they create. At Giotto, we take immense pride in serving our guests with traditional Italian cuisine, ensuring an unforgettable dining experience.


Giotto Italian Restaurant